TitleLetter from George Biddel Airy, to George Gabriel Stokes, regarding a paper 'On the diurnal inequalities of terrestrial magnetism, as deduced from observations made at the Royal Observatory, Greenwich, from 1841 to 1857' by George Biddell Airy
Date16 June 1863
DescriptionHas corrected an error as noted by one of the referees, and responds to some of the criticisms of the paper.

Subject: Physics and Chemistry

[Published in the Philosophical Transactions of the Royal Society, 1863]
